Excerpt from Elements of Animal Physiology, Chiefly Human Very considerable experience as a Teacher of Physiology, with the youthful and adult of both sexes, has proved to the writer the facility with which the civa vooe teaching of Elemen tary Physiology may be made perfectly sound and thorough, when supplemented with the aid of good diagrams, a good text-book, and the free use of the black-board, and of the lungs, heart, kidney, eye, &c., of the Sheep, and of such other objects as may be readily obtained from the butcher, for the illustra tion of the general structure of the corresponding Organs of the human body; while the body of the living frog or tadpole is amply sufficient to illustrate the general phenomena of the circulation and the properties of the living tissues. The teacher should also occasionally dissect a small animal, as a rabbit, recently killed with chloroform, before his class. A Human Skeleton and a cheap Microscope will likewise be found invaluable aids to the earnest teacher. About the Publisher Forgotten Books publishes hundreds of thousands of rare and classic books.
